Medallia Inks Trademark Deal with Delta Airlines
MENLO PARK, CA—January 5, 2005—Medallia, Inc. and Delta Airlines (DAL) today signed an agreement to avoid any confusion over their respective trademarks: Medallia’s “Medallia" trademark and Delta's "Medallion" trademark associated with its SkyMiles™ frequent flier program. Under the terms of the agreement, Medallia will not use the Medallia trademark when collecting customer feedback about passenger airline services or airline loyalty programs. "This is a fair agreement that avoids even the possibility of customer confusion about the two marks,” said Medallia CEO Borge Hald. He added that because Medallia has been in sales discussions with airlines, the company is actively developing new names under which to offer its services to the airline industry.
